Summer Friday Adventure Series: A CMCCYC Community Initiative
Join the Cape May County Council for Young Children for a summer of discovery, movement, and outdoor fun! Starting Friday, July 3rd, 2026, we are launching a specialized summer pilot program designed to keep local children engaged and active during the summer break.
This is a free, community-driven initiative created by the Council to provide high-quality enrichment for our families.
What We Do 🌿 Our "Adventure Series" focuses on stealth learning. Each session is designed to challenge a child's logic and curiosity through hands-on activities, nature exploration, and creative problem-solving. We move beyond the classroom to help children see the science and patterns in the world around them.
Mindfulness & Movement 🧘 Every session incorporates guided stretching and focused breathing exercises. We believe that a ready mind starts with a regulated body, so we prioritize physical wellness and mobility in every "mission" we undertake.
The Details 📍
When: Every Friday starting July 3, 2026.
Morning Crew (Ages 4-6): 9:00 AM – 11:00 AM | Focus on sensory discovery and foundational logic.
Afternoon Crew (Ages 7-10): 1:00 PM – 3:00 PM | Focus on creative architecture and advanced problem-solving.
Where: Various community parks and centers throughout Cape May County (Locations announced weekly to confirmed families).
Limited Enrollment ⚠️ To ensure a high-quality experience and individualized attention, we maintain small groups of 4. Because of this, spots are extremely limited.
